libgpg-error doesn't build with new nawk

After new nawk version import, libgpg-error doesn't build:
===> Building for libgpg-error-1.4_1
make all-recursive
Making all in intl
Making all in m4
Making all in src
nawk -f ./mkstrtable.awk -v textidx=3 ./err-sources.h.in >err-sources.h
nawk -f ./mkstrtable.awk -v textidx=3 ./err-codes.h.in >err-codes.h
nawk -f ./mkerrnos.awk ./errnos.in >code-to-errno.h
nawk -f ./mkerrcodes1.awk ./errnos.in >_mkerrcodes.h
cc -E _mkerrcodes.h | grep GPG_ERR_ | nawk -f ./mkerrcodes.awk
>mkerrcodes.h
nawk: field separator [ ]+GPG_E... is too long
source line number 66
*** Error code 2
Change in question:
--- src/contrib/one-true-awk/lib.c 2005/05/16 19:11:33 1.1.1.4
+++ src/contrib/one-true-awk/lib.c 2007/06/05 15:33:51 1.1.1.5
@@ -40,9 +40,9 @@ char *fields;
int fieldssize = RECSIZE;
Cell **fldtab; /* pointers to Cells */
-char inputFS[100] = " ";
+char inputFS[10] = " ";
^^^^^
Is maximum length of field separator documented somewhere?
